    poplar plywood

    i am making a compter desk for my sister and her husband and was going to use poplar. does anybody know where i can get a sheet of poplar plywood for the desktop, or if not, can anyone suggest another plywood i might use that would be similiar in appearance and texture?

    RE: poplar plywood

    Poplar is a poor choice for furniture as it is so soft.

    Maple ply is available and will look similar.

    RE: poplar plywood

    Guys,

    Poplar is considered as the poor mans answer to cherry (not as good as birch or the real thing). Only because of its similar grain. To compensate for the green to brown natural coloring wash the effected areas with a 50/50 bleach/H2O solution, flush completely. As for what plywood? I think I'd opt for birch veneer .
